Pinhole Leak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pipe is leaking 5 gallons per hour | Yes | No | DIY can handle small leaks like this. You can replace the pipe yourself. |
| Pipe is leaking 50 gallons per hour | No | Yes | This is a significant leak that needs professional attention to prevent further damage. |
| Leak is affecting multiple rooms | No | Yes | This is a complex issue that needs a professional’s expertise to address. |
| Leak is hidden behind a wall or under a floor | No | Yes | This need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and address the issue. |

Pinhole Leak Water Removal Cost in Westford, MA
The cost of pinhole leak water removal can vary depending on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Westford, MA. These estimates are based on our experience with similar situations and should give you a rough idea of what to expect. Our team’s expertise can provide a more accurate quote after an on-site assessment.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Response |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of leak,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Leak Detection and Isolation | $1,000 – $5,000 | Complexity of leak,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$2,000 – $10,000 | Affected area size, equipment needed, local conditions |
| Repairs and Restoration | $3,000 – $15,000 | Extensiveness of repairs, materials needed, local conditions |
